Archos Brings 5 New Android Tablets to the Table

Tablet talk is stirring all around the Android community at the moment as Samsung is set to formally announce their Galaxy Tab tomorrow with IFA 2010 kicking off on Friday. Archos has announced 5 new tablets set to indulge in the tablet feeding frenzy. Each tablet comes with their name being their display size. Thanks for making it easier on us, Archos.

Features of all 5 devices include:

  • Android 2.2
  • USB 2.0
  • WiFi b/g/n
  • TFT LCD screens of various resolutions
  • G-sensors

Below is a more detailed list of specs pertaining to each device:

  • Archos 10.1 : 8 or 16 GB of internal memory + microSD card slot, 1024×600 screen, 1GHz ARM A8, front-facing VGA camera, mini HDMI out
  • Archos 7.0 : 8GB internal memory + microSD card slot OR 250GB internal HDD (!), 800×480 screen, 1GHz ARM A8, front-facing VGA camera, mini HDMI out
  • Archos 4.3 :  8 or 16 GB of internal memory + microSD card slot, 480×854 screen, 1GZh ARM A8, 2MP camera for taking pictures and videos, mini HDMI out
  • Archos 3.2 : 8 GB internal memory, 400×240 screen, 800 MHz ARM A8, composite video out
  • Archos 2.8 : 4 or 8 GB internal memory, 320×240 screen, 800 MHz ARM A8

The Archos tablet 4.3 and above will be equipped with a kickstand and speakers and it looks like none of these devices will support the Android Market, so get ready to side load your applications. Pricing and available have not yet been announced, but we should learn a little more following IFA.
